Description:

Most insurance plans accepted.

That's the fine print at the end of the commercial for The Pastures - a field of impossibly green grass behind the cemetery, ringed in electric fence, where the town of Palmdale keeps its dead relatives until their bodies finish giving out. There's a shuttle tour with barred windows. There's a hotline: 1-888-DIGNITY. There's a jingle.

Sixteen-year-old Cindy Scott starts keeping a journal the day the first infected man is wheeled into her father's E.R. She keeps writing through the curfews, the checkpoints, and the Halloween decorations nobody bothers to take down. She's still writing when her beautiful, vicious older sister sneaks out to meet a boy and comes home bitten - and when their father quietly empties both girls' college funds on a black-market vaccine that isn't working.

Audrey is turning. It's taking months. Her bedroom is across the hall.

And out on the street, someone has started spray-painting CLEARED on the doors of houses where living people used to be.

Notes from the End of the World is a zombie apocalypse told in diary entries - funny, filthy-mouthed, and quietly devastating. The dead are the least of what's coming.
